Preferred Qualifications:
- Minimum 3 years' experience in Consulting, Higher Education, and/or other relevant experience
-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ail
- Strong analytical skillset
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
- Strong experience and proficiency in analytical tools such as Microsoft Excel, as well as other Microsoft Office products
- Demonstrated track record of successful delivery and implementation of ERP systems (e.g. Human Capital Management, Finance, Supply Chain, Procurement, Student Information Systems)
- Certification or direct experience implementing Workday, Oracle, PeopleSoft systems
Job Requirements:
- Current U.S. work authorization required
- Bachelor's Degree from an accredited college or university
- Current MBA student (individuals who have completed their MBA program prior to December 2025 will not be considered for this position)
- MBA Graduate degree obtained by May/June 2026
- Willingness and ability to travel every week (Monday-Thursday) on a 60-80% basis annually; work extended hours as necessary
